Several factors are contributing to the rapid expansion of the robotic vacuum cleaner market. Some of the key drivers include:
Technological Advancements: Continuous improvements in robotics AI and sensor technology have enabled robotic vacuums to navigate homes more efficiently clean more thoroughly and even avoid obstacles.
Smart Home Integration: With the rise of smart homes consumers are increasingly looking for appliances that can integrate seamlessly with their other smart devices. Robotic vacuums that can be controlled via smartphone apps voice assistants or home automation systems are in high demand.
Time Saving and Convenience: Robotic vacuum cleaners are designed to work autonomously allowing users to save time and effort in maintaining clean floors. Busy consumers are increasingly opting for automated solutions that help them balance their work and personal lives.
Rising Disposable Income: As disposable income rises more consumers can afford to invest in robotic vacuum cleaners which were once considered luxury items. This has expanded the potential customer base.
Increased Awareness and Adoption: Awareness of the benefits of robotic vacuum cleaners has been increasing especially with the growing presence of social media influencers tech bloggers and review sites. Positive word of mouth has encouraged more people to try robotic vacuums.

The robotic vacuum cleaner industry is constantly evolving with several technological innovations paving the way for smarter and more efficient devices. Here are some of the key advancements shaping the market:
Artificial intelligence AI and machine learning are revolutionizing the robotic vacuum cleaner market. AI enables robotic vacuums to map and navigate homes with greater precision while machine learning allows these devices to improve their cleaning patterns over time. For example a robotic vacuum may learn to avoid obstacles or clean more thoroughly in high traffic areas. As these technologies continue to improve robotic vacuums will become even more autonomous and efficient.
One of the most significant advancements in robotic vacuums is the ability to create real time maps of the user’s home. Smart mapping technology uses a combination of sensors and cameras to map the layout of a room or entire house. This allows the vacuum to clean more efficiently by avoiding obstacles cleaning high priority areas and returning to its charging station when necessary.
Integration with voice assistants like Amazon Alexa and Google Assistant has made controlling robotic vacuums easier than ever. Users can simply say "Alexa start the vacuum " or "Hey Google clean the living room " and the vacuum will begin its cleaning cycle. Many models also come with companion apps that allow users to schedule cleaning sessions monitor progress and adjust settings remotely.
Modern robotic vacuums are equipped with a range of sensors including infrared sensors cliff sensors and anti collision sensors. These sensors help the vacuum avoid obstacles detect stairs or ledges and navigate tight spaces. Some high end models even feature advanced sensors that can detect the type of surface they are cleaning allowing them to adjust suction power accordingly.
Battery life has always been a concern for robotic vacuum cleaners but manufacturers have made significant improvements in this area. Modern robotic vacuums feature long lasting lithium ion batteries that provide enough power to clean larger areas without frequent recharging. Additionally many models now come with self charging capabilities where the vacuum returns to its docking station to recharge when its battery is low ensuring that it’s always ready for the next cleaning cycle.
